當前位置:編程學習大全網 - 源碼下載 - django是前端還是後端

django是前端還是後端

前端

django是前端還是後端

前端。

Django是壹個開放源代碼的Web應用框架,由Python寫成。采用了MTV的框架模式,即模型M,視圖V和模版T。它最初是被開發來用於管理勞倫斯出版集團旗下的壹些以新聞內容為主的網站的,即是CMS(內容管理系統)軟件。並於2005年7月在BSD許可證下發布。這套框架是以比利時的吉普賽爵士吉他手DjangoReinhardt來命名的。

django是前後端分離嗎

不管使用什麽編程語言進行web開發,都有兩種開發模式,壹種是前後端不分離,壹種是前後端分離。前後端不分離開發模式耦合度高,適合純網頁開發,前後端分離的開發模式耦合度低,前端可以通過訪問接口來對數據進行增刪改查。因此,論開發方便程度來說,前後端不分離要更被開發者們廣泛使用的壹種。django框架中有壹個DjangoRestFramework,簡稱DRF,是壹款功能強大、基於Django框架開發的、用於構建符合RESTful風格WebAPI的、前後端分離的商業化開發工具包,是目前非常流行的商業級技術框架之壹。

1.用manage.pyrunserver啟動Django服務器時就載入了在同壹目錄下的settings.py。該文件包含了項目中的配置信息,如前面講的URLConf等,其中最重要的配置就是ROOT_URLCONF,它告訴Django哪個Python模塊應該用作本站的URLConf,默認的是urls.py。

2.當訪問url的時候,Django會根據ROOT_URLCONF的設置來裝載URLConf。

3.然後按順序逐個匹配URLConf裏的URLpatterns。如果找到則會調用相關聯的視圖函數,並把HttpRequest對象作為第壹個參數(通常是request)

  • 上一篇:劍網1歸來每日答題答案是什麽
  • 下一篇:支付寶支付開發-退款
  • copyright 2024編程學習大全網